Data Technician Apprentice
Gather data from various internal and external sources, ensuring it is accurate and up-to-date.
Clean and preprocess data to remove any inconsistencies or errors, making it ready for analysis.
Organise data into structured formats, such as databases or spreadsheets, for easy access and analysis.
Support the team in analysing data to identify trends, patterns, and insights within the data.
Create detailed reports and dashboards using BI tools like Power BI, or Excel that allow colleagues to explore data and gain insights quickly.
Track and mon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) to measure the effectiveness of various business processes and initiatives.
You’ll work alongside experienced colleagues who will mentor and guide you, while studying towards a nationally recognised Data Technician Apprenticeship.

QA's Data Essentials Level 3 apprentice will learn to:
Source, format and present data securely, using Microsoft Excel, Power BI and SQL. Analyse structured and unstructured data to support business outcomes. Blend data from multiple sources as directed. Communicate outcomes appropriate to the audience. Apply legal and ethical principles when manipulating data.QA’s Data Essential Level 3 apprenticeship programme enables your organisation to:
